Alaska Power Authority Susitna Hydroelectric Project draft position paper, fisheries issue F-2.6
Significance of potential changes in pH on salmon and resident fish habitats and populations downstream of the dams. Significance of potential changes in heavy metal concentrations on salmon and resident fish habitats and populations downstream of the dam. Significance of potential changes in dissolved gas on salmon and resident fish habitats and populations downstream of the dams. Significance of changes in water temperature on salmon and resident fish habitats and populations downstream of the dams. Significance of change in water quality parameters (nutrients) on salmon and resident fish habitats and populations downstream of the dams. Significance of impoundment effects on resident fish habitats and populations upstream of the dams. Significance of physical effects of access corridors on fish habitat. Significance of the physical effects of transmission line corridors on fish habitat. Significance of water quality and quantity effects of construction camps and permanent village on fish habitat. Significance of water quality and stream morphology effects of borrow and spoil areas on fish habitat. Formulation and implementation of a post-construction plan to monitor significant impacts and the efficacy of specific mitigation measures.
